        The only ones I've successfully found in the documentation is from
the 12.3 Source-Route Briding Configuration Guide:

An access list that passes a frame if it is a NetBIOS frame (SAP = 0xF0F0)
An access list that passes a frame if it is an SNA frame (SAP = 0x0404)

! Access list 201 passes NetBIOS frames (command or response)
access-list 201 permit 0xF0F0 0x0001
!
access-list 202 permit 0x0404 0x0001 ! Permits SNA frames (command or
response)
access-list 202 permit 0x0004 0x0001 ! Permits SNA Explorers with NULL DSAP
